1. int fork();
创建一个进程,返回0为子进程,大于0为父进程,小于0出错
2.void exit(int status);
终止当前进程的执行,并把参数status返回给当前进程的父进程,而当前进程所有的缓冲区数据将会被自动写回并关闭所有未关闭的文件。其中,exit(0)表示程序正常终止,而exit(1)/exit(-1)则表示程序出错/异常终止。
3.pid_getpid(void);
返回值为当前进程的进程号。
pid_getppid(void);
返回值为当前进程的父进程的进程号。
阅读(984) | 评论(0) | 转发(0) |